Downtown Berkeley, Berkeley, CA Guía Local

¿Cuánto cuesta alquilar un apartamento en Downtown Berkeley?
| Dormitorios | Precio Promedio | Más barato | Más caro |
|---|---|---|---|
| Apartamentos Estudio en Downtown Berkeley | $2,583 | $800 | $5,270 |
| Apartamentos 1 Dormitorios en Downtown Berkeley | $3,385 | $695 | $10,000+ |
| Apartamentos 2 Dormitorios en Downtown Berkeley | $2,772 | $746 | $10,000+ |
| Apartamentos 3 Dormitorios en Downtown Berkeley | $3,206 | $608 | $8,865 |
| Apartamentos 4 Dormitorios en Downtown Berkeley | $3,190 | $883 | $10,000+ |
| Apartamentos 5 Dormitorios en Downtown Berkeley | $2,659 | $911 | $10,000+ |
| Apartamentos 6 Dormitorios en Downtown Berkeley | $1,900 | $748 | $10,000+ |
